我正在通过端口81播放我的视频,但是,当我点击视频的中间时,我没有得到我期望的(转发)。这与我的lighttpd安装或我使用的软件有关吗?我正在使用一个框架,其中所有必须完成的工作在lighttpd流媒体值上设置为'1',如果正确安装了lighttpd应该是好的(事实上我已经为另一个安装做了这个并且工作了,并且我不知道现在的问题是什么。
我在CentOS上使用lighttpd 1.5。通过端口81流式传输。以下是我添加到lighttpd.conf和modules.conf的一些行:http://paste.lighttpd.net/2517
从我在firebug中看到的内容,该视频正在通过mydomain.com:81进行流式传输。 Firefox的Live HTTP标头也没有问题;它们使用lighttpd和octet / stream作为应用程序显示正在流式传输的视频。
任何可以帮助我解决此问题的输入?
非常感谢!
答案 0 :(得分:1)
很老的问题,但很有趣,因为我必须解决同样的问题。
当您不使用HTML5播放器时,Lighttpd本身不支持转发/伪流。
您需要为lighttpd添加一个模块,可在此处找到: http://h264.code-shop.com/trac/wiki
你必须自己合并一些构建lighttpd的文件,它写在他们的网站上。 不要使用lighttpd-1-4-18的源代码,因为有bug而无法构建,请改用1.4.28。
同样有趣:http://flash.flowplayer.org/plugins/streaming/pseudostreaming.html